They are the long-tailed tits or Shima
Enagas in Japanese!
These
birds are unique to this particular island in Japan. People also compare them
to cotton candy.
What's so special about this long-tailed
tits bird??
![long tailed tits bird](https://blogger.googleusercontent.com/img/b/R29vZ2xl/AVvXsEg9OQf0i5fkHZ1tLGsJIzT78pYvuNCLWV3b8auYOhqoWbeHgwg1VZ63JzgVhuDX_lkCgCKutZQNlh-2-LiDlHCZ3X-HVDzr3NNN5WI_6hCWtFDhUpoPOey0U90b0dDD99IK1T4MSM6aXPqxP7Vztd4yBijzk2aiGCEh42Jf69kjDfbmY6Kt5D2I8jyBCg/s16000/long-tailed-tits-bird-2.jpg)
First
thing is their size. They are extremely small with a body length of about 13cm
- 15cm. Anyhow, their tails are double the length of this.
These tit
birds have black eyebrows at the beginning but lose them as their transition
takes place into adults.
![long tailed tits bird](https://blogger.googleusercontent.com/img/b/R29vZ2xl/AVvXsEjgYatyS1xkF7MqaBJOTL9WWv2jhkQd2ruKQ-16Wk2bvN4Wzdy2NBWkFEZe7R2UfbQn-r_d1syMogzVme5X8ellL8gYjT9Gkaq_GxA_-Q0W2zSEq5cM3o_XC32IsByCAn_3TBczxBTmwAZiTpZi7o-8j7WNWLvFNbeu0w7wyyyUnZPJuc1RYqPcn7isxA/s16000/long-tailed-tits-bird-3.jpg)
With the
loss of their black eyebrows they remain with a complete white face that makes
them look like snowmen. Their snowy white colour perfectly blends the long
winters in the island.
![long tailed tits bird](https://blogger.googleusercontent.com/img/b/R29vZ2xl/AVvXsEijb6x4LNkxUn4GOvt_7JAWniU2brV_qVT22-jsAf-bEna9J7ZVUOeZIzSmbbPu09a7mLwr7FQYCMWA9KHzGuruP2HresCvR843hbsU3Ve06dq_iPHLCyt6sDqUp7ql_gbQ8Z39JoIDkHs2BMjI4fWcghtXGrlmHwGNxG7BV4mC3qtyv7fu-ifwqPyH2w/s16000/long-tailed-tits-bird-4.jpg)
These
small birds live in flocks of about 20-30. They have very cool acrobatic tricks
to flutter around.
![long tailed tits bird](https://blogger.googleusercontent.com/img/b/R29vZ2xl/AVvXsEhGsrMvNWQ-HzYh-1RtBezFJynSNxduwykusQWDqAxboTeKfeqnqnvU3m7arRFImjmSlFXW7TRcRtQ8HASq8ebUkOkoEHUxZPUgzQAZ_aAfFgK10a_-BHI45jdg3k2tRU9ZTU526orYB6hWvlZwG3XY78C8_yQfECVUUGISe-5MIiD_IcbRM7DvqH2JFA/s16000/long-tailed-tits-bird-5.jpg)
The female birds lay nearly 7-10 eggs at
a time to maintain their general counts.
![long tailed tits bird](https://blogger.googleusercontent.com/img/b/R29vZ2xl/AVvXsEgtvKCNy02Jmttfuv4WjYl7W2TKTskbu7mDkgrlloIaJkkyo1372siFV384RqLsMdQnk789H54bUSA3E47JJGRhAmcoru3WRnQQyuWhVC57VCPN8UGV4YzDbq5suhQb1xpPpmS2O0eMm4WUwEONYsMFvuRKMWlt_3DtGqG9hoebfGX3yPwXxkjR6R8Pow/s16000/long-tailed-tits-bird-6.jpg)
Their
families always rebound due to the sheer count of eggs that they lay during the
winter season. They become vulnerable too.
The
unique version of the long-tailed tits can be seen only in Hokkaido. Yet,
different versions of them are spread in Western Europe across Russia all the
way to Japan.
